What is the future of domains? Will they loose their value?

It's unlikely that domains will lose their value in the foreseeable future. Domains continue to be an essential component of the internet infrastructure, and they play a crucial role in branding, marketing, and search engine optimization. Moreover, with the growth of the internet and the increasing number of websites and online businesses, the demand for domains is likely to continue.

However, the value of domains may change in the future. For example, the emergence of new top-level domains (TLDs) like .app, .shop, .xyz, and others could make some traditional TLDs less desirable, and their value could decrease. Additionally, changes in search engine algorithms, social media platforms, and other online marketing channels could also affect the value of domains.

Overall, it's safe to say that domains will remain an essential part of the internet and online business, but their value and desirability could change over time depending on various factors.
